
Hanuman Jayanti is one of the most sacred and celebrated festivals in Hindu culture. It marks the birth of Lord Hanuman, the divine vanara (monkey god) and the greatest devotee of Lord Rama. In 2025, Hanuman Jayanti will be observed on April 12, which falls on the Purnima (full moon day) of the Chaitra month according to the Hindu lunar calendar.
Lord Hanuman symbolizes strength, courage, devotion, humility, and loyalty. He is worshipped for protection from evil, overcoming obstacles, and gaining spiritual strength. This festival is not just a celebration of His birth, but also a powerful reminder of how devotion, discipline, and purity of heart can help us conquer even the mightiest of challenges.

Why Hanuman Jayanti is Celebrated?

Hanuman Jayanti celebrates the incarnation of Lord Hanuman, who is considered the 11th Rudra avatar of Lord Shiva. He was born to Anjana and Kesari, and blessed by Vayu Dev (the wind god), which is why He is also called Pavanputra Hanuman. His birth was not just a divine event but a part of cosmic design to assist Lord Rama in His fight against evil.
His life is an epitome of unmatched devotion (bhakti), bravery, and service to dharma. From burning Lanka with His tail, flying across oceans, carrying the Sanjeevani mountain, to humbly bowing before Rama, every act of Hanuman is a divine lesson in humility, power, and spiritual focus.

Symbolism of Lord Hanuman

Lord Hanuman is a multi-dimensional deity whose symbolism goes far beyond mythological narratives:
- Tail – His tail is symbolic of his power and ego-less service.
- Mace (Gada) – Symbolizes authority, discipline, and inner strength.
- Open Heart with Rama-Sita – Symbol of ultimate devotion.
- Flying Posture – Represents freedom of the soul through surrender and action.
How to Impress Lord Hanuman in 2025

If you seek Lord Hanuman’s blessings in 2025 for strength, peace, and protection, here are powerful ways to please Him with devotion and discipline:
- Chant Hanuman Chalisa Daily
One of the most effective ways to connect with Hanuman is through the recitation of the Hanuman Chalisa. Authored by Tulsidas, the 40 verses are a reservoir of spiritual power. Recite it 108 times on Hanuman Jayanti for maximum benefits. Best time: Morning before sunrise or during Brahma Muhurat (4 am to 6 am). Light a ghee lamp, offer red flowers, and place a tilak of sindoor and jasmine oil on His idol. - Observe a Vrat (Fast)
Fasting on Hanuman Jayanti helps purify the mind and body. You can observe:
- Nirjala Vrat – Without food and water till sunset.
- Phalahari Vrat – Only fruits and milk.
- Break the fast after sunset with prasad and Hanuman aarti.
- Offer Sindoor and Jasmine Oil
Lord Hanuman is fond of sindoor (vermilion). It’s said He once applied it all over His body to ensure Lord Rama lives long. Offering a mix of sindoor and jasmine oil is considered highly auspicious. Apply it to His idol with devotion and chant:”Bajrangbali ki jai!”
- Recite Hanuman Bahuk or Sunderkand: These texts are powerful and healing: Hanuman Bahuk (by Tulsidas) is great for curing diseases and health problems. Sunderkand from Ramcharitmanas brings mental peace and victory in difficult situations. Read them on Hanuman Jayanti with a clean heart and focused mind.
- Help the Needy and Feed Monkeys: Lord Hanuman is also the protector of the weak. On His birthday: Donate food, clothes, or money to the poor. Feed monkeys, cows, or stray animals. Offer boondi ladoos or jaggery-roti to monkeys, which is considered His favorite.
- Visit a Hanuman Temple: On Hanuman Jayanti, visit a temple dedicated to Lord Hanuman, especially during the aarti hours (sunrise or sunset). Offer: Coconut, Bananas, Boondi ladoos, Betel leaves, Red flags (dhwaja) Participating in sankirtans, bhajans, and Hanuman Abhishek rituals in temples amplifies your blessings.
- Observe Brahmacharya (Celibacy and Purity): Lord Hanuman is a Brahmachari (celibate) and values purity of thoughts and actions.
- To gain His blessings: Control your speech and thoughts: Avoid lying, anger, and negativity. Practice meditation, silence, and simple living.
- Wear Red Clothes and Use Red Flowers: On Hanuman Jayanti, dress in red or saffron-colored clothes, and offer red hibiscus flowers to His idol. The color red symbolizes energy and Mars, and it resonates deeply with Lord Hanuman’s divine vibration.
Mantras to Chant on Hanuman Jayanti 2025

Here are some powerful mantras to invoke Lord Hanuman’s grace:
Hanuman Moola Mantra:
- “Om Hanumate Namah”
- Hanuman Gayatri Mantra:
- “Om Anjaneyaya Vidmahe
- Vayuputraya Dhimahi
- Tanno Hanumat Prachodayat”
- Bajrang Bali Mantra for Protection:
- “Om Namo Bhagvate Anjaneyaya Mahabalaaya Swaha”
Chant any of these 108 times with a tulsi mala, preferably after taking a bath and sitting facing east.

- Dos and Don’ts on Hanuman Jayanti
Dos:
- Wake up early and take a holy bath.
- Wear clean red or saffron clothes.
- Maintain a sattvic (pure) diet.
- Be humble and serve others.
- Chant mantras or read scriptures.
Don’ts:
- Avoid non-vegetarian food and alcohol.
- Do not engage in gossip or arguments.
- Don’t cut your nails or hair.
- Avoid tamasic activities like laziness or over-sleeping.
